Another option is to remove the Lin Bus CBC 3 signal going to the camera (Tailgate connector or BCM (C5/E-45).
It will lose the camera guide lines but camera will output video as long as the key is in the run position/powered up (if I understand what you're trying to do correctly).

I might try pulling the LIN bus connection going to the camera, to verify if it's actually the camera that drops out. The button turns on the camera in forward or parked it just goes blue once I get rolling too fast.
What would be the ideal option would be a way to intercept the speed part LIN signal. I don't need the active guidelines so if that all I lose, probably worth gaining being able to use the camera whenever.
Does anyone know if the same video drop out occurs with the cargo cam in a '15? If it doesn't I bet you could parallel the camera video feed to those inputs and use the cargo cam button instead.
